Daftar Isi:
2025 Pengarang: John Day | [email protected]. Terakhir diubah: 2025-01-13 06:57
Pada artikel kali ini saya akan membuat Termometer menggunakan ring 16 bit RGB Neo pixel.
Suhu maksimum yang dapat diukur dengan alat ini adalah 48 derajat Celcius.
Jadi karena menggunakan 16 LED, maka setiap LED RGB akan mewakili 3 derajat Celcius.
Warna dan jumlah LED akan menyesuaikan dengan suhu yang diukur. misalnya, suhu yang diukur adalah 30 derajat Celcius. Led yang akan hidup sebanyak 10 buah. Lihatlah gambar di atas. untuk warna saya menggunakan gradasi dari hijau ke merah.
Langkah 1: Komponen yang Diperlukan
Komponen yang harus disiapkan:
- Arduino nano
- RGB Cincin Neo Piksel
- DHT11
- Kawat jumper
- USB mini
- Papan Proyek
Perpustakaan yang Diperlukan
- DHT
- Adafruit_NeoPixel
Langkah 2: Merakit Semua Komponen
Lihat gambar di atas untuk melakukan perakitan komponen
Arduino ke RGB & DHT
+5V ==> VCC RGB & (+) DHT
GND ==> GND RGB & (-) DHT
D2 ==> DALAM RGB
D4 ==> KELUAR DHT
Langkah 3: Pemrograman
Download file sketsa yang saya taruh di bawah ini:
Langkah 4: Hasil
Lihat gambar di atas untuk hasilnya.
Suhu yang diukur adalah 30 derajat Celcius. Jika 3 derajat Celcius = 1 LED, maka 30 derajat Celcius = 10 LED. Dan secara terpisah saya menggunakan gradasi dari hijau ke merah.